The Government has failed to deliver the 10,000 extra nursing places they promised

Jonathan Ashworth MP, Labour’s Shadow Health Secretary, responding to reports in Nursing Times that universities are reducing the size of their nursing courses in the wake of the removal of bursaries in England, said:

“The Government’s decision to remove the bursaries for health degrees is a terrible misjudgment. They have failed to deliver the extra 10,000 nursing places they promised and in fact some universities are now planning to offer fewer places.

“Applications for nursing degrees have fallen by 23% this year and now universities say they have not yet received enough responses from prospective students to fill the number of training places they are offering. 

“The Government has created a crisis in the nursing workforce which is causing chaos for patients. They should urgently revisit their decision to charge fees for health degrees before it is too late.”

Richard Burgon congratulates Sir Ian Burnett on his appointment as Lord Chief Justice

Richard Burgon MP, Labour’s Shadow Secretary of State for Justice, commenting on the appointment of Sir Ian Burnett as the new Lord Chief Justice, said:

“I congratulate Sir Ian Burnett on his appointment as Lord Chief Justice of England and Wales from October 2017.

“One of the Lord Chief Justice’s key responsibilities is representing the views of the judiciary to Parliament and the government.

“I look forward to working with Lord Justice Burnett in upholding the independence of the judiciary, which is a cornerstone of our legal system.”
